Output 3d13ab5933087995a109e3b643c65f6ec370aa60748e65a1cb1bd48c893a74d5:0

value
56949956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f7c62755e2efbc1b3b4c7abe6774929cc472e6 OP_EQUAL
address
MPm1xFxruAWxX3fGALW4a7AegJjC61BKSL
transaction
3d13ab5933087995a109e3b643c65f6ec370aa60748e65a1cb1bd48c893a74d5
spent
true